Output 3bb2a5e4e1a831b0e43c01af7cc86b0b33bc09d66065dad014b04c761fbb4f8e:1

value
1520411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50de3e6b2e000364feaa7d97f65517be18a9b92b OP_EQUAL
address
394cDfLGcbuWLuJmwRUyRicQqqMSbEPtZY
transaction
3bb2a5e4e1a831b0e43c01af7cc86b0b33bc09d66065dad014b04c761fbb4f8e
confirmations
15854
spent
false